The Mutual Wills package with Last Wills and Testaments you have found is for a married couple with adult children. It provides for the appointment of a personal representative or executor, designation of who will receive your property and other provisions, including provisions for your spouse and children. This package contains two wills, one for each Spouse. It also includes Instructions.


The wills must be signed in the presence of two witnesses, not related to you or named in the wills. If your state has adopted a self-proving affidavit statute, a state specific self-proving affidavit is also included and requires the presence of a notary public to sign the wills.

To create a valid will in Missouri, there are specific minimum requirements you must fulfill. The will must be in writing, signed by the testator, and witnessed by at least two individuals. In Missouri, a will can be deemed invalid for several reasons. Common issues include lack of proper signatures, failure to have the required number of witnesses, or if the testator was not of sound mind when creating the will.
